Understanding the MAP Sensor on the 2016 Toyota Hilux
The 2016 Toyota Hilux, a reliable workhorse known for its robustness and versatility, employs various sensors to keep its engine running smoothly. One of the key components found on many modern vehicles is the MAP sensor, which stands for Manifold Absolute Pressure sensor. But is the MAP sensor relevant or even used on the 2016 Hilux? The answer depends on the engine type and fuel system of the vehicle, which varies between petrol and diesel models.
For the petrol versions of the 2016 Toyota Hilux, especially those equipped with EFI (Electronic Fuel Injection) engines, a MAP sensor is indeed present and plays an important role. These engines use the MAP sensor to measure the absolute pressure inside the intake manifold. This information helps the engine's computer accurately calculate the air density and determine the correct amount of fuel to inject. By doing this, it ensures optimal combustion, which leads to improved fuel efficiency, lower emissions, and better overall engine performance.
On the other hand, many diesel variants of the 2016 Hilux rely less on a MAP sensor and more on other sensors such as mass air flow (MAF) sensors or direct pressure sensors specific to turbocharging systems. Diesel engines typically interpret air intake and boost pressure differently compared to petrol engines, so depending on the setup, a conventional MAP sensor as found in petrol engines might not be used. Instead, the engine management system relies on sensors specially designed to suit the diesel combustion process.
So, if you drive a petrol 2016 Toyota Hilux, rest assured that your vehicle contains a MAP sensor that is crucial to how the engine functions. For diesel Hilux owners, especially those with newer CRD (Common Rail Diesel) engines, the system may exclude a traditional MAP sensor in favour of alternative pressure sensing methods.
Now, assuming the 2016 Hilux you are servicing is fitted with a MAP sensor, it is worth knowing what it does and how to maintain it. The MAP sensor's primary job is to provide the engine computer with real-time data about the pressure inside the intake manifold. This pressure data helps the ECU (Engine Control Unit) assess how much air is entering the engine, which it uses along with other sensors' data to determine the ideal fuel delivery and ignition timing.
If the MAP sensor is dirty, faulty or failing, it can send incorrect data to the ECU. This can result in a range of potential issues including poor fuel economy, rough idling, stalling, or even difficulty starting the engine. Drivers might also notice a drop in engine power or an increase in exhaust emissions. The vehicle's check engine light might illuminate as a warning, often with error codes related to air-fuel mixture or sensor malfunction.
Maintaining the MAP sensor isn't complicated but it is often overlooked during routine servicing. Regular checks should include inspecting the sensor for signs of dirt or oil contamination. A quick clean using an appropriate electronic sensor cleaner can restore its function if dirt is the culprit. However, if the sensor is faulty or damaged, replacement is the best option as repairs are rarely practical.
Replacing the MAP sensor on the 2016 Toyota Hilux is generally straightforward. The sensor is commonly mounted on or near the intake manifold, and it connects to the wiring harness with a simple plug. Taking note of the part number specific to your Hilux's engine and model is crucial to ensure compatibility. Installing a new sensor should restore the correct manifold pressure readings and help the engine breathe easy again.
During servicing, it's wise to carry out a scan with an OBD-II scanner to check for any stored fault codes related to the MAP sensor. These codes provide invaluable insights into whether the sensor is functioning as it should or if there might be wiring or vacuum leaks affecting the signal.
